
Imagick::whiteThresholdImage 함수의 기본값은 0.0입니다. 이 함수의 파라미터는 흰색 임계값을 설정하는 데 사용됩니다. 파라미터는 0.0에서 1.0 사이의 값을 가질 수 있습니다.
이 함수를 사용하여 이미지의 흰색 부분을 제거하는 방법은 다음과 같습니다.
1. Imagick::whiteThresholdImage 함수를 사용하여 흰색 임계값을 설정합니다.
2. Imagick::stripImage 함수를 사용하여 흰색 부분을 제거합니다.
이 함수를 사용할 때 발생할 수 있는 오류는 다음과 같습니다.
1. 파라미터의 유효성 검사를 하지 않으면 오류가 발생할 수 있습니다.
2. 이미지의 형식이 지원되지 않으면 오류가 발생할 수 있습니다.
오류를 해결하는 방법은 다음과 같습니다.
1. 파라미터의 유효성 검사를 하여 오류를 방지합니다.
2. 이미지의 형식이 지원되지 않으면 다른 형식을 사용하거나, Imagick::stripImage 함수를 사용하여 흰색 부분을 제거합니다.
예를 들어, 다음과 같이 코드를 작성할 수 있습니다.
#hostingforum.kr
php
$imagick = new Imagick('image.jpg');
$imagick->whiteThresholdImage(0.5);
$imagick->stripImage();
$imagick->writeImage('output.jpg');
이 코드는 'image.jpg' 이미지의 흰색 임계값을 0.5로 설정하고, 흰색 부분을 제거한 후 'output.jpg'로 저장합니다.
2025-06-03 05:55